Molded pulp packaging is manufactured through a 5-step process: pulping recycled paper fiber, molding it into shape, drying, trimming, and finishing — all within 25-45 days from mold design to first shipment.

Step 1: Pulping

Recycled corrugated cardboard, newsprint, or kraft paper is shredded and mixed with water in a hydrapulper. The slurry (98% water, 2% fiber) is refined to the required consistency. Dye is added here for custom colors.

Step 2: Molding

Step 3: Drying

Wet molded parts enter a drying tunnel (conveyor belt, 120-180°C) for 20-40 minutes. Residual moisture content drops from 70% to 8-12%. Energy consumption is the largest cost factor in molded pulp production.

Step 4: Trimming

Parts are hot-cut from the mold carrier sheet using a trim press. Precision trimming removes the flash edge while maintaining dimensional accuracy. For deep-relief products, hand-trimming may be used for critical visual surfaces.

Production Timeline

StageDuration
Mold design & approval5-10 days
Mold fabrication (aluminum)10-14 days
Sample production & fit test3-5 days
Production optimization3-5 days
Mass production & QC5-10 days
Total25-45 days

What This Process Is NOT

This process is not injection molding — it cannot produce hermetic seals, threadings, or snap-fit features. It is not paperboard folding — it cannot fold flat for shipping. Molded pulp parts are rigid, 3D-formed, and designed for their final shape.

Frequently Asked Questions

Q: How long does the molding process take per part?
A: Cycle time is 30-90 seconds per part depending on thickness and complexity. Each mold produces 1-4 parts per cycle.

Q: Can molded pulp be made in any color?
A: Yes. Dye is added during pulping. Natural brown (unbleached) and white (bleached) are standard. Pantone-matched colors available at 10K+ units.

Q: Is the dried pulp food-safe?
A: Molded pulp from recycled fiber is food-safe when produced in a controlled facility. Coated options (PLA, beeswax) are available for direct food contact.
